Ticket #4412 — ScanBridge integration dropping connections

The Vexlar barcode scanner integration on the Dockmere warehouse floor is failing to hold a connection to the ingest service. Roughly one in five scans times out, and the retry queue is backing up during the morning shift. We've ruled out firmware, since the handhelds work fine against staging. The ingest pods log pool exhaustion, so we suspect the lookup database is the bottleneck. For verification, the affected environment connects using the following.

primary connection of yagep-kahip = redis://giliel_svc:zYiKsLL2PLpfPL@db-348f.xolmarsys.corp:5432/fenwyn

Verify that every retry path in the Tollgate payment service attaches the original idempotency key rather than generating a new one. Confirm the key store TTL (72 hours) exceeds the maximum retry window, and that duplicate submissions return the cached response with a replay header. Spot-check the reconciliation report from the last release candidate for double-charge anomalies. Evidence: retry integration test suite output plus the key-store metrics dashboard snapshot. Sign-off for this item rests with the engineer identified directly below.

named custodian: Brivan Eliath Quenox Frador

## Local setup

Thumbq is the thumbnail generation queue behind Pixelbarn. Clone the repo, install deps, and start the worker with the dev flag — it'll pick up jobs from a local queue stub, no broker needed. Generated thumbs land in ./out. The worker records job status in a small metadata database, which it reaches via the connection string below.

replica DSN, yahaf-yagaf: mongodb://tamath_svc:a2netSk3RZMuTj@db-d084.novacsoft.internal:5432/ralmir

## Office Move — Document Transport

Archive boxes from the Pellwick Annex move Thursday. Records team tags each box, seals with blue tape, logs box numbers on the transfer sheet. Shredding bins stay behind. Grayline Movers handles the run; one staff member rides along. No box leaves untagged. The courier hand-over must follow the confidential instruction given below.

handover note for yagef-bagep: the drudor pelius courier leaves the kasdor zorvan norir ledger at gate 8016 under passcode 755406